#390e81 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#390e81 is composed of 22.4% red, 5.5% green and 50.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 55.8% cyan, 89.1% magenta, 0% yellow and 49.4% black. It has a hue angle of 262.4 degrees, a saturation of 80.4% and a lightness of 28%. #390e81 color hex could be obtained by blending #721cff with #000003. Closest websafe color is: #330099.

#390e81 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#390e81 has RGB values of R:57, G:14, B:129 and CMYK values of C:0.56, M:0.89, Y:0, K:0.49. Its decimal value is 3739265.

Shades and Tints of #390e81
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020105 is the darkest color, while #f7f2fe is the lightest one.

Tones of #390e81
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#47454a is the less saturated color, while #36038c is the most saturated one.
